GCC Bio Based Polyvinyl Chloride Market Overview

  • The GCC Bio Based Polyvinyl Chloride Market is valued at USD 380 million, based on recent analysis. Growth is driven by increasing demand for sustainable materials and stringent environmental regulations that are encouraging the adoption of eco-friendly biopolymers in construction and automotive applications. Enhanced processing technologies and rising consumer preference for low-carbon alternatives further support market momentum.
  • Key players in this market include the United Arab Emirates and Saudi Arabia, supported by robust industrial infrastructure and strategic investments in sustainable materials. Globally, key companies like INEOS, Formosa Plastics, Solvay, and Westlake Chemical are advancing bio-based PVC solutions through expertise in biopolymer development, extensive production capabilities, and integration with construction and automotive sectors.
  • An important regulatory development is the upcoming expansion of the UAE’s single-use plastics restrictions under Ministerial Decision No. 380 of 2022, effective from January 1, 2026, which bans common items made from fossil-based plastics unless manufactured from plant-based or biodegradable materials such as PLA biopolymers or recycled content. This policy actively promotes sustainable material innovation and aligns with broader circular economy goals.

GCC Bio Based Polyvinyl Chloride Market Industry Analysis

Growth Drivers

  • Robust PVC Production Infrastructure:The GCC produced **564,000 tons** of polyvinyl chloride in future, primarily driven by Saudi Arabia's strong industrial base. This high production capacity supports the infrastructure necessary for the adoption of bio-based PVC, facilitating a smoother transition to sustainable alternatives. The existing facilities and expertise in PVC production create a favorable environment for bio-based innovations to flourish, aligning with global sustainability trends.
  • Strong PVC Market Value Base:The GCC PVC market value reached **USD 791 million** in future, providing a solid financial foundation for investments in bio-based alternatives. This substantial market value indicates a robust demand for PVC products, which can be leveraged to promote bio-based options. The financial scale encourages manufacturers to explore sustainable materials, thus enhancing the market's potential for bio-based PVC growth and adoption.
  • High Imports Reflect Demand Pull:In future, PVC imports into the GCC totaled **437,000 tons**, highlighting a significant demand for PVC products. This reliance on imports presents a unique opportunity for domestic bio-based alternatives to capture market share. By developing local bio-based PVC production capabilities, the GCC can reduce dependency on imports while meeting the growing consumer demand for sustainable materials, thus fostering local industry growth.

Market Challenges

  • High Production Costs:The production costs of bio-based plastics are approximately **25–35% higher** than those of conventional PVC. This cost disparity poses a significant barrier to the widespread adoption of bio-based PVC in a market that is sensitive to pricing. Manufacturers may face challenges in justifying the higher costs to consumers, which could hinder the growth of bio-based alternatives in the GCC region.
  • Dominance of Conventional Plastics:Conventional plastics account for over **92%** of the total plastics market in the GCC. This overwhelming presence of traditional materials creates a challenging environment for bio-based alternatives to gain traction. The established market dynamics favor conventional products, necessitating innovative strategies and incentives to encourage the adoption of bio-based PVC solutions among consumers and businesses alike.

Market Opportunities

  • Leverage Established Trade Infrastructure:The GCC exported **214,000 tons** of PVC in future, alongside imports of **437,000 tons**. This existing trade infrastructure provides a robust platform for scaling bio-based PVC exports. By utilizing established logistics and distribution networks, manufacturers can effectively replace imports with domestically produced bio-based alternatives, enhancing local industry resilience and sustainability.
  • Capture Global Sustainability Trend Momentum:The global bio-attributed PVC market is growing at an impressive rate of **25% annually**. This trend, coupled with recycled PVC constituting up to **22%** of total production, presents a significant opportunity for GCC manufacturers. By aligning with these global sustainability trends, local companies can innovate and export eco-friendly PVC products, tapping into a rapidly expanding market.
